Output 63ab8c0ac9d8f191a1527b84a9e391218bf613dbca8c0dae2eda0a8d22b5f39a:5

value
1896578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c381bfa1395e8564adf9f8055b7d1df92f0ce8 OP_EQUAL
address
3Do1KvCgVJECUeigF92bdhkiiP1oovXf4N
transaction
63ab8c0ac9d8f191a1527b84a9e391218bf613dbca8c0dae2eda0a8d22b5f39a
spent
true